Surely many Christians wonder why they are not baptized with
the Holy Spirit though they have been saved many years ago.
To understand this, we must separate between the gospel of God
and theology. The gospel of God is the direct contrary of the
theology. The theology is a human attempt to understand
God and spiritual things, but the gospel does go to the other
direction. God's gospel is God's personal message to us.
Do you want to get knowledge of something in the Bible, as the
baptism in water, the new birth, or the baptism in the Holy Spirit?
Then it is not a theologian you must consult, but you must consult
our Master, Jesus Christ. He does not teach theologies, but he
gives us gospel. He proclaims his will by the Holy Spirit and the
Bible.
Jesus said that the Spirit of truth would guide us into all truth.
John 16:13-15. And still today the Holy Spirit continues with
that. No one of us is learned enough yet, and we are all the times
depend upon the Holy Spirit. To the same extend that we give
ourselves over to him and want to obey him, he gives us his light
over God's word, and he will guide us into all truth.
"Knowing this first, that no prophecy of the scripture is of any
private interpretation. For the prophecy came not in old time by
the will of man: but holy men of God spake as they were moved
by the Holy Ghost." 2 Peter 1:20-21.
Some Christians think that they have the whole gospel, and that
they lack nothing of the truths of the Bible in their preaching.
Nevertheless, such an attitude is dangerous and leads to stagnation
and retrogression in their spiritual life. Please, compare
Rev. 3:14-22. Only those who are thirsty come to Jesus
and drink of the living water. John 7:37-39.
